Output 31d50e0a0ae58ade21c8e5d4a35db14776a18f7291d3998f4af51bc9b6c7538a:0

value
840768870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6b283541819ad00def0d2480412b3c373a47bc2 OP_EQUALVERIFY OP_CHECKSIG
address
Lbsy6RiaBmhx6ajDrC9TNrybxK4UgMosnX
transaction
31d50e0a0ae58ade21c8e5d4a35db14776a18f7291d3998f4af51bc9b6c7538a
spent
true